Develop a Consistent Practice Establishing aconsistent yoga practiceis fundamental for aspiring Hatha Yoga teachers, as it lays the foundation for bothpersonal growthandeffective instruction. A well-structured yoga schedule not only helps in developing discipline but also allows teachers to investigate their own practice deeply.
Students should aim forpractice variety, incorporating different styles and postures to improve their skills and keep their sessions engaging. Mindfulness techniques are vital during training, as they foster self-awareness and enable teachers to connect with their students on a deeper level. Integratingbreathing exercisesinto daily practice can also improve focus and promote relaxation, significant qualities for effective teaching. Furthermore, a consistent practice aids ininjury prevention, as understanding one's body and limitations becomes paramount. Teachers can modelsafe practicesfor their students, helping them cultivate a respectful relationship with their own bodies. Settingpersonal goalsis another significant aspect of developing a consistent practice. By identifying specific objectives—such as mastering achallenging asanaor increasing flexibility—teachers can measure their progress and stay motivated. This commitment to personal growth not only enriches their own experience but also inspires students to pursue their own aspirations. Enhance Physical Fitness Aconsistent yoga practicenaturally leads to improvements inphysical fitness, which is vital for anyone preparing forHatha Yoga teacher training. To improve physical fitness effectively, aspirants should focus on several key areas that contribute to comprehensive well-being. Here are four significant aspects to take into account: 1.Strength Training: Incorporatingstrength traininghelps build muscle, which supports multiple yoga poses and improves overall stability. 2.Flexibility Exercises: Regularflexibility exercisesenhance range of motion, making it easier to perform asanas with proper alignment and reduce the risk of injury. 3.Breathing Techniques: Masteringbreathing techniquesnot only aids in relaxation but also increases lung capacity, which can boost endurance during longer sessions. 4.Nutrition Habits: Maintaining healthynutrition habitsfuels the body, guaranteeing that it has the necessary energy to support a demanding yoga and training routine.
In addition to these points, focusing onbody awarenessandcentral stabilityis vital. Practitioners should develop a keen sense ofalignment focus, which can improve posture and reduce the likelihood of injuries. Ultimately, combining these fitness elements prepares individuals not just physically but also mentally for their role as a Hatha Yoga teacher. By committing to this comprehensive approach, they can guarantee they are strong, flexible, and well-prepared to guide others on their yoga experiences. Cultivate Mental Resilience Mental fortitude is vital for anyone preparing forHatha Yoga teacher training, as it equips individuals to handle thechallengesthat can arise during their course. Developing mental toughness not only improvespersonal growthbut also fosters a deeper connection to the students they will eventually serve. To cultivate this toughness, one can integratemindfulness techniquesinto theirdaily routine. These practices encourage individuals tostay present, promoting an awareness of thoughts and feelings without judgment. Engaging in mindfulness can take different forms, such as meditation, breathing exercises, or mindful movement, each allowing practitioners to center themselves amidst the chaos of life. Through establishing a regular mindfulness practice, individuals can improve theiremotional awareness, which is vital when facing the ups and downs of teacher training. This emotional awareness enables one to recognize stressors and triggers, allowing for proactive management of challenging situations. Furthermore,journalingcan serve as a powerful tool forreflection, helping individuals to process their experiences andemotionsthroughout the training. By documenting their experience, they can gain insights into their mental state, which can lead to greater self-understanding and toughness.
